Introducción a RMAN Oracle
Oracle RMAN significa Oracle Recovery Manager. Es un Oracle Database Client que automatiza las tareas de copia de seguridad y recuperación en sus bases de datos. Realiza una copia de seguridad, recupera y restaura los archivos de la base de datos. Los administradores de respaldo de datos no están obligados a iniciar el proceso de respaldo. DBA (administradores de bases de datos) puede proteger los datos en las bases de datos Oracle mediante RMAN (Recovery Manager).
¿Qué es RMAN Oracle?
RMAN (Recovery Manager) es un cliente de base de datos Oracle, que automatiza la administración de estrategias de respaldo y protege la integridad de la base de datos. Durante la restauración y la copia de seguridad de los datos, se proporciona la detección de corrupción a nivel de bloque. Se admiten muchas técnicas de respaldo, como la política de retención de archivos de respaldo, la paralelización de los flujos de datos de respaldo o restauración y el historial detallado de la operación de respaldo. Oracle Recovery Manager puede realizar recuperación de medios en bloque, duplicación automatizada de bases de datos, copias de seguridad incrementales, conversión de datos multiplataforma, compresión binaria y copias de seguridad cifradas. Maneja todas estas tareas de mantenimiento que se realizan antes o después de la copia de seguridad o recuperación de las bases de datos.
Arquitectura Oracle de RMAN
La arquitectura de Oracle Recovery Manager (RMAN) tiene los siguientes componentes:
- Base de datos de destino: es una base de datos que contiene archivos de datos, archivos de control y archivos de rehacer que se necesitan para hacer una copia de seguridad o recuperarlos. RMAN utiliza el archivo de control de la base de datos de destino para recopilar metadatos sobre la base de datos de destino. Las sesiones del servidor que se ejecutan en la base de datos de destino realizan todo el trabajo de copia de seguridad y recuperación. Es un componente obligatorio para RMAN.
- Cliente RMAN: es la aplicación cliente que realiza todas las operaciones de copia de seguridad y recuperación para la base de datos de destino. Utiliza Oracle net para conectarse a la base de datos de destino para que su ubicación se pueda encontrar en cualquier host que esté conectado al host de destino utilizando Oracle Net. Es una interfaz de línea de comandos que ayuda a emitir los comandos de copia de seguridad, recuperación, SQL y RMAN especiales. Es un componente obligatorio para RMAN.
- Esquema del catálogo de recuperación: es el usuario presente en la base de datos del catálogo de recuperación que tiene las tablas de metadatos creadas por RMAN. RMAN cambia periódicamente los metadatos del archivo de control de la base de datos de destino al catálogo de recuperación. Es un componente opcional.
- Base de datos del catálogo de recuperación: es una base de datos que contiene el catálogo de recuperación que contiene metadatos que RMAN utiliza para realizar tareas de copia de seguridad y recuperación. Se puede crear un catálogo de recuperación para contener metadatos de múltiples bases de datos de destino. También es un componente opcional.
- Base de datos en espera física: es una copia de la base de datos primaria que se actualiza con registros de rehacer archivados. Tiene el mismo Id. De base de datos y nombre de base de datos que la base de datos primaria, pero tiene un DB_UNIQUE_NAME diferente. RMAN puede crear, respaldar y recuperar bases de datos en espera. No es un componente obligatorio.
- Base de datos duplicada: también es una copia de la base de datos primaria, pero se utiliza con fines de prueba. Su DB_ID también es diferente de la base de datos primaria.
- Área de recuperación rápida: es una ubicación de disco utilizada para almacenar archivos relacionados con la recuperación, como archivos de control, registros retrospectivos de archivos rehacer en línea, copias de seguridad de RMAN y archivos rehacer archivados. Los archivos presentes en el área de recuperación rápida son administrados automáticamente por la base de datos Oracle y RMAN.
- Administrador de medios: es una aplicación específica del proveedor que permite a RMAN hacer una copia de seguridad del sistema de almacenamiento, como la cinta. Es un componente opcional.
- Catálogo de gestión de medios: es un repositorio de metadatos específico del proveedor relacionado con la aplicación de gestión de medios. También es un componente opcional.
- Oracle Enterprise Manager: es una interfaz basada en navegador que incluye respaldo y recuperación a través de RMAN. También es un componente opcional.
Cómo funciona RMAN
El entorno RMAN tiene una base de datos de destino y un cliente RMAN. RMAN realiza copias de seguridad en las bases de datos de destino y la aplicación cliente gestiona todas las tareas de copia de seguridad y recuperación de la base de datos de destino. RMAN utiliza una API de administrador de medios para trabajar con el hardware de respaldo. Un usuario debe iniciar sesión en Oracle RMAN y luego pedirle que haga una copia de seguridad de la base de datos del usuario. RMAN luego copia el archivo al directorio especificado por el usuario.
Los administradores de bases de datos pueden usar los comandos de respaldo de RMAN para administrar RMAN. Los comandos se pueden usar para convertir archivos de datos, ejecutar una copia de seguridad, actualizar o recuperar esquemas de catálogo, iniciar una base de datos flashback, crear una base de datos duplicada y muchas más tareas.
Características de RMAN
- Conjuntos de copia de seguridad: los conjuntos de copia de seguridad están formados por piezas de copia de seguridad en las que Oracle RMAN almacena datos. Una pieza de respaldo es un archivo binario que solo RMAN puede crear o restaurar. Los conjuntos de copia de seguridad se forman agrupando piezas de copia de seguridad que permiten a los administradores de bases de datos proteger múltiples archivos de datos, registros de archivado y archivos de parámetros del servidor. RMAN puede cifrar y descifrar los datos escritos en conjuntos de copia de seguridad.
- Registros de rehacer archivados: cada base de datos de Oracle tiene su registro de rehacer que almacena los cambios realizados en la base de datos. Los registros de rehacer archivados contienen el grupo de registros de rehacer guardados fuera del sitio. Si la base de datos no se cierra correctamente, entonces conduce a una base de datos inconsistente que puede restaurarse utilizando registros de rehacer archivados.
- Recuperación Flash: Las copias de seguridad realizadas por RMAN se crean en el área de recuperación flash de la base de datos Oracle en el disco. FRA es un directorio que tiene registros de rehacer en línea y archivados, registros de control, registros de flashback y copias de imágenes. Las copias de seguridad que ya no son necesarias se eliminan para dejar espacio libre para nuevas copias de seguridad. Las copias de seguridad que se eliminarán se deciden de acuerdo con las políticas realizadas por DBA.
- Base de datos Flashback y recuperación de medios: Oracle Flashbacks y recuperación de medios se utilizan para restaurar datos. Los flashbacks permiten que los DBA pasen a un tiempo anterior para eliminar los errores del usuario o la corrupción de datos llamada recuperación en un punto en el tiempo. Las fallas de los medios se resuelven usando Media Recovery. La base de datos Flashback ayuda a restaurar cualquier base de datos por completo en cualquier momento en lugar de realizar una recuperación incompleta.
- Cifrado de conjuntos de copia de seguridad: RMAN proporciona tres modos de cifrado, es decir, Cifrado transparente, Cifrado de modo dual y Cifrado de contraseña.
Ventajas de RMAN
- Selecciona la copia de seguridad más adecuada para la recuperación de la base de datos.
- Utiliza comandos simples.
- El usuario puede respaldar automáticamente la base de datos en cinta.
- Se puede recuperar una base de datos en el nivel del bloque de datos.
- Solo los bloques de datos modificados se pueden recuperar utilizando la funcionalidad de copia de seguridad incremental que reduce el tiempo de copia de seguridad.
- Se pueden crear copias de seguridad seguras utilizando la función de cifrado.
- El clon de la base de datos se puede crear en el host remoto utilizando el comando duplicado de RMAN.
- Las bases de datos físicas en espera se pueden crear simplemente.
¿Cómo te ayudará esta tecnología en el crecimiento profesional?
Debido a un aumento en los datos, el proceso de manejo de la base de datos y el miedo a perder datos también está aumentando. Por lo tanto, se requiere la recuperación de la base de datos y, por lo tanto, las oportunidades de trabajo para esto también están aumentando. El salario promedio de los trabajos relacionados con Oracle RMAN varía de $ 87, 000 a $ 131, 000 por año.
Conclusión
Este artículo está relacionado con los conceptos básicos y el funcionamiento de Oracle RMAN cuyo alcance aumenta día a día debido al aumento de datos, por lo tanto, es un cliente de base de datos eficiente que ayuda a recuperar las bases de datos fácilmente.
Artículos recomendados
Esta ha sido una guía de ¿Qué es RMAN Oracle? Aquí discutimos los componentes, el trabajo, las habilidades, el crecimiento profesional y las ventajas de RMAN Oracle. También puede consultar nuestros otros artículos sugeridos para obtener más información.
- ¿Qué es el almacén de datos?
- Carrera en Oracle
- ¿Qué es la seguridad cibernética?
- ¿Qué es Apache Spark?
- ¿Qué es una consulta y tipos de consultas Oracle?